        November 2007 to October 2008 Long Rang Forecast 

  • Winter will be slightly milder than normal, thanks to a mild November and March and despite colder-than-normal temperatures in December and February. Precipitation will be slightly above normal in North Carolina and below normal elsewhere, with average amounts of snow and ice. The coldest periods will be in early and late December, mid- and late January, and mid-February. Snow and ice will occur in interior locations in mid- to late January and mid-February. April and May will be a bit warmer and drier than normal. Summer will be slightly hotter than normal, with below-normal rainfall in eastern North Carolina and above-normal rainfall elsewhere. The hottest temperatures will occur in early June, early to mid- and late July, and early August. September and October will be cooler and drier than normal.
